Discover the Soaring Luxury Home Sales in the Bay Area Thanks to AI Wealth

Luxurious Bay Area home with stunning views and a hot tub.

Luxury Home Sales in Silicon Valley: A Thriving Market

The year 2025 has marked a significant revival in the luxury real estate market across the Bay Area, particularly driven by the influx of new tech money. Wealthy buyers, largely influenced by the rocketing value of technology stocks, have renewed their interest in upscale properties, resulting in a booming market for homes priced above $5 million. This uptick indicates a recovery as sales have outpaced broader market trends, reflecting a return to pre-pandemic levels.

Sales Surge: A Closer Look at Price Increases

In 2025, the San Francisco housing market has seen extraordinary growth. Reports indicate that sales of luxury homes surged, with properties priced at $3 million and above experiencing a staggering 29% increase in sales year-over-year. More impressively, homes over $5 million skyrocketed by 54% within the same timeframe, showcasing a stark contrast to average market conditions. The demand is not only pushing home values but also accelerating competition among buyers looking to secure their luxury investments.

Tech-Driven Economic Impact on Home Sales

The role of technology companies in this surge cannot be understated. As the heart of Silicon Valley, the Bay Area has historically been integral to economic innovation and growth. The increase in venture capital and startup activity has lent itself to higher disposable incomes for many residents, providing them the means to invest in high-value properties. Consequently, the environment has also attracted a wave of off-market sales, further highlighting the desirability of luxury homes in regions such as Pacific Heights, San Jose, and Oakland.

Future Trends: What Could this Mean?

The future of the Bay Area’s luxury real estate market appears promising. As the tech industry continues to thrive, particularly in areas linked to AI and machine learning, it’s likely that demand for upscale homes will remain robust. Looking ahead, experts predict that this luxury home sales trend could sustain itself, contributing not just to individual wealth, but also positively impacting local economies through increased job growth and commercial investment.

Understanding the Market Dynamics

In addition to high demand, there are key economic factors at play that every prospective buyer and seller should understand. For instance, the resilience of the San Francisco economy amidst broader market fluctuations means that real estate investments in this area come with both risk and reward. Moreover, being informed about the region's developing infrastructure and ongoing urban investments can guide future home purchasing decisions.

The Bay Area’s luxury real estate sector sets a precedent and serves as a barometer for the overall health of the regional business landscape. This symbiotic relationship between tech growth and real estate appreciates further examination, reflecting the future of urban living in Silicon Valley.

KB Home's Shift to Built-to-Order: A Smart Move in a Tight Housing Market

Update Understanding KB Home's New Strategy Amid Market Shifts As the housing market in the Sunbelt continues to soften, KB Home, a significant player ranked No. 526 on the Fortune 1000, is facing a challenging environment with dwindling pricing power. The homebuilder has announced a strategic shift towards built-to-order homes, aiming to bolster its margins in a tough economic time. With the recent fourth quarter earnings revealing a 17% housing gross profit margin—its lowest since 2016—KB Home’s transition signals a broader trend among builders reevaluating their approaches in response to market pressures. The Impact of Pricing Power Loss on Homebuilders Over the past year, many homebuilders, including KB Home, have experienced a significant decline in pricing power. This has resulted in the need for strategic adjustments to maintain sales and profitability. For instance, KB Home's average selling price has plummeted by 8.8% since its peak in 2022, emphasizing the urgency of adapting pricing strategies to current market realities. While other competitors like Lennar have leaned towards financing incentives, KB Home has opted predominantly for outright price cuts. KB Home's Built-to-Order Focus: A Viable Solution? KB Home is putting significant emphasis on its built-to-order model, which allows customers to personalize their homes, thus reducing inventory risks. This strategy aims to achieve greater value from their communities by focusing on superior margins associated with built-to-order homes. By increasing this approach, KB Home plans to align starts with built-to-order sales, boosting its gross margins by the end of fiscal 2026. Future Market Predictions: Will the Strategy Work? Analysts predict that embracing built-to-order homes may not only restore margin stability but could also drive customer satisfaction as buyers seek more personalized living spaces. However, KB Home's management acknowledges that a market characterized by affordability concerns and uncertain economic conditions complicates the outlook. The success of this shift hinges on continued improvements in construction efficiency and adaptability to consumer preferences, especially in key areas where demand is currently faltering. Final Thoughts: Adapting Strategies in a Volatile Market The landscape for homebuilders like KB Home is undoubtedly shifting, but its commitment to innovation through built-to-order homes may present an opportunity for recovery and sustainable growth. As housing demand continues to evolve, builders who can combine strong operational strategies with customer-focused solutions will likely lead the path forward in the competitive market.

Discovering Potential: Oversold Real Estate Stocks Ready for a Price Surge

Update Profiting from Oversold Real Estate Stocks As the real estate sector grapples with turbulence, opportunities loom for astute investors. A wave of market corrections has led to a number of stocks trading at significantly lower prices, with some appearing poised for a rebound. This article explores three real estate stocks identified as oversold, based on their Relative Strength Index (RSI) readings, indicating potential for price surges in the near term. Healthpeak Properties Inc: Caution May Lead to Opportunity At the forefront is Healthpeak Properties Inc (NYSE:DOC), which has endured a challenging month, suffering a dip in stock price to $15.78, with a troubling RSI of 26.4. Recently downgraded by analysts from Buy to Hold, its trading has hit a 52-week low. However, the recent selling pressure raises questions: Could this create an entry point for value-focused investors with a longer-term outlook? Fermi Inc: Reevaluation on the Horizon The second candidate, Fermi Inc (NASDAQ:FRMI), has seen its share price plummet by approximately 43% recently. Closing at $8.25 and reflecting an RSI value of 28.5, the stock may suggest that the recent downturn could be an overreaction to market sentiment rather than a fundamental flaw. Investors looking for momentum stocks might take notice of stocks bouncing back after sharp declines. Kilroy Realty Corp: Signs of Recovery? Lastly, Kilroy Realty Corp (NYSE:KRC) round out this lineup, currently priced at $37.55 with an RSI value that sits at 23.9. After negative analyst ratings, many may view its current state as undesirable. However, contrarian investors, recognizing the RSI's implications, might consider Kilroy’s potential for recovery due to historically resilient real estate fundamentals. Technical Analysis: A Future Perspective Utilizing technical analysis tools like moving averages and RSI indicators, interested investors can gauge whether these stocks might indeed be gearing for an upward trend. Stocks identified as oversold can often yield attractive opportunities coupled with the right market catalysts. Though caution is warranted given the recent downgrades and sell-offs, the opportunities in oversold stocks such as those listed above merit consideration for value-seeking strategies.

How the New Elementary School In Mission Bay May Impact Home Values in 2026

Update How a New Elementary School Can Drive Home Values Up The Mission Bay neighborhood in San Francisco is on the brink of transformation with the anticipated opening of its first public elementary school in August 2026. Local real estate experts are already speculating that this development will lead to a significant increase in home prices, as families seek out quality education options for their children. Understanding the Impact on the Housing Market Home values often reflect the desirability of an area. Schools are one of the critical factors influencing real estate decisions among families. The new school is expected to attract more residents, particularly young families who prioritize education. This demand could create upward pressure on prices, a trend already evident in other California neighborhoods where new schools have opened. Current Trends in Mission Bay Real Estate Recently, Mission Bay has been witnessing an upswing in condo sales, showcasing interest from homebuyers. With improved local amenities and now a school on the horizon, agents predict that the neighborhood's potential will only rise. The San Francisco Business Times reports that as infrastructure improvements continue and the mission to enhance community services grow, it may become an appealing area for prospective homeowners. Broader Implications for the Bay Area Economy San Francisco’s real estate market is intricately tied to broader economic trends, especially as tech companies continue to expand in the neighboring Silicon Valley. Increased residential development paired with robust job growth in technology and venture capital sectors can lead to new families moving to the Bay Area, further elevating the demand for housing and education. Why Homebuyers Should Pay Attention Now The decision to purchase a home is influenced not just by current market conditions but by future expectations as well. For potential homebuyers, the imminent opening of the Mission Bay school serves as a clarion call to act sooner rather than later. Investments made now could yield significant long-term benefits as the neighborhood develops. As Mission Bay prepares for its upcoming changes, prospective buyers and investors alike should consider how these developments may enrich not only the community but their financial futures as well.
